i know there is no cheap way in the sport. but can someone point me in the right direction on what the cheapest car to build
Mark, Mike, I thing you're both in the right place. In the thread title the question asked is "what is the best motor and car combo for the money". To that I would have to say either a new Mustang or an LS powered GTO or Vette. In the first post the question changes to "what is the cheapest car to build?". The answer to that would probably be some mid 80s turbo car or 5.0 Mustang.
The question that hasn't been asked yet is "which combo is the best?" and as long as Stock and SS are around that question will be argued.
